GM’s next-generation hands-free driver assist system, Ultra Cruise, will be powered by a scalable compute architecture featuring system-on-chips developed by American semiconductor company Qualcomm Technologies, Inc.

Ultra Cruise Hands-Free System Gets New Architecture

Source: General Motors announcement DETROIT – GM announced that its next-generation hands-free driver assist system, Ultra Cruise, will be powered by a scalable compute architecture featuring system-on-chips developed by American semiconductor company Qualcomm Technologies, Inc. General Motors will introduce new Super Cruise capabilities on six model year 2022 vehicles, including the GMC Sierra seen here towing with Super Cruise

Super Cruise Added to Six GM Vehicles for 2022

Source: General Motors announcement DETROIT – General Motors will introduce new Super Cruise capabilities on six model year 2022 vehicles in the first quarter of 2022. Super Cruise is the industry’s first true hands-free driver-assistance technology allowing drivers to travel…
